> Sometimes you need a very basic jsonpath that is just like a very easy OGNL 
> like to grab some data from a json payload that are nested.
> "foo.bar.title"
> "foo.bar.year"
> You can use jq / jsonpath and those more powerful languages but then you get 
> trapped into their complex syntax. 
> Instead when you are using simple OGNL then you have a dot syntax and ?. to 
> mark it optional, and then [xxx] to index in an array.
